From ad8b32b51649769bd8be49799c2dce10a487e8cf Mon Sep 17 00:00:00 2001 From: Ben Bridle Date: Mon, 3 Feb 2025 09:30:05 +1300 Subject: Allow using logging macros without importing LogLevel --- src/lib.rs |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'src/lib.rs') diff --git a/src/lib.rs b/src/lib.rs index e0386ab..7af1f20 100644 --- a/src/lib.rs +++ b/src/lib.rs @@ -25,7 +25,7 @@ pub fn get_log_level() -> LogLevel { #[macro_export] macro_rules! info { ($($tokens:tt)*) => { - if *$crate::LOG_LEVEL.lock().unwrap() <= { LogLevel::Info } { + if *$crate::LOG_LEVEL.lock().unwrap() <= { $crate::LogLevel::Info } { eprint!("{}{}[INFO]{}: ", $crate::BOLD, $crate::BLUE, @@ -41,7 +41,7 @@ pub fn get_log_level() -> LogLevel { #[macro_export] macro_rules! warn { ($($tokens:tt)*) => {{ - if *$crate::LOG_LEVEL.lock().unwrap() <= { LogLevel::Warn } { + if *$crate::LOG_LEVEL.lock().unwrap() <= { $crate::LogLevel::Warn } { eprint!("{}{}[WARNING]{}{}: ", $crate::BOLD, $crate::YELLOW, @@ -58,7 +58,7 @@ pub fn get_log_level() -> LogLevel { #[macro_export] macro_rules! error { ($($tokens:tt)*) => {{ - if *$crate::LOG_LEVEL.lock().unwrap() <= { LogLevel::Error } { + if *$crate::LOG_LEVEL.lock().unwrap() <= { $crate::LogLevel::Error } { eprint!("{}{}[ERROR]{}: ", $crate::BOLD, $crate::RED, -- cgit v1.2.3-70-g09d2